Ollie is a 7-year-old dappled grey john mule with a black mane and tail everyone oohs and aahs over. He’s a blast to ride, and he has the looks to go with it. He is sure-footed and not scared of anything we’ve put him through.
This guy came from a family I know well; he is dog Gentle! Ollie sure does love the attention and is the first to greet you in the field or stall. Ollie is out of a walking horse mare and does a cute little gaited shuffle, but he was a little rougher than the previous owner liked. Also, at only 14 hands high, he wasn’t making the cut for what they needed him for. There is absolutely no funny business with this guy. He saddles up quietly and will ride off just as you ask. He may give a funny holler every now and then, but it’s quite cute! Ollie has been stalled and turned out and does just fine in either scenario.
We’ve put Ollie through our program, and he’s passed every test with flying colors. He is quiet on the trail, crosses water, goes through any thick Kentucky brush, and has even helped pack a baby calf to the barn. He would also be super cute as a 4-H project or even a dude ranch prospect. He will walk/trot/lope on a loose rein. Ollie is young enough to make what you want of him and can last years to come.
